3D Printing in Construction Market Poised for Exponential Growth

The 3D printing in construction market is undergoing a rapid transformation, driven by its ability to revolutionize the way we design, build, and inhabit our spaces. This innovative technology offers unparalleled design freedom, increased efficiency, reduced waste, and a more sustainable approach to construction. The market is witnessing a notable acceleration in the adoption of 3D printing in construction, particularly in sectors like residential construction, infrastructure projects, and architectural designs. The emergence of innovative printing technologies and the development of new building materials specifically tailored for 3D printing are fueling the market's growth.
